One of the primary problems addressed by flat roof vent installation is moisture buildup. Flat roofs are prone to accumulating condensation and excess humidity, which can lead to issues such as mold growth, roof deck deterioration, and structural damage over time. Installing vents helps mitigate these problems by promoting continuous airflow and reducing moisture retention. Additionally, proper ventilation can prevent the formation of ice dams during colder months, which can cause leaks and damage to the roofing material. These services are essential for maintaining the integrity and longevity of flat roofing systems.

Material Costs - The cost for materials like vents and flashing typically ranges from $150 to $400 per vent. Prices vary based on the type and quality of materials selected by local pros in Voorhees, NJ area.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$200 and $500 per vent. The total cost depends on the complexity of the roof and local contractor rates.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include roof preparation or removal of old vents, which can add $50 to $200 per vent. These costs vary depending on the specific project requirements.
Total Project Cost - Overall, flat roof vent installation services typically range from $400 to $1,100 per vent. Exact prices depend on the scope of work and local service provider pricing in Voorhees, NJ area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
